xeruf
|
64a5ba421b
|
zulip: reenable override
|
2022-07-07 11:32:17 +01:00 |
xeruf
|
d4998796fe
|
suitecrm: use underscore variable separators
|
2022-07-07 10:58:20 +01:00 |
xeruf
|
02ded85f75
|
people: disable usage of secret
|
2022-07-06 11:38:10 +01:00 |
xeruf
|
6964edab44
|
basic: restructure directories
|
2022-07-06 11:25:31 +01:00 |
xeruf
|
19790176ba
|
suitecrm: add db secrets
|
2022-07-06 11:24:59 +01:00 |
xeruf
|
ad11b0df68
|
suitecrm: fix config
|
2022-07-06 10:24:04 +01:00 |
xeruf
|
ea930584b1
|
people: configure admin user
|
2022-07-06 10:16:49 +01:00 |
xeruf
|
cc6fbd792a
|
basic: remove some extras
|
2022-07-05 15:11:20 +01:00 |
xeruf
|
caa5fa2055
|
apps: correct oversights
|
2022-07-05 15:08:32 +01:00 |
xeruf
|
750ff1faa7
|
apps: reenable letsencrypt
|
2022-07-05 12:02:40 +01:00 |
xeruf
|
6b9dcc718a
|
production: reenable app kustomization
|
2022-07-05 11:58:05 +01:00 |
xeruf
|
37686c5814
|
production: fix kustomization names
|
2022-07-05 10:02:44 +01:00 |
xeruf
|
4745df2aac
|
basic: own kustomization for namespace
|
2022-07-05 09:52:20 +01:00 |
xeruf
|
da50e3080b
|
production: remove apps to trace namespace deletion
|
2022-07-04 17:29:50 +01:00 |
xeruf
|
37a50b1a8f
|
gitea: remove kubernetes kustomization
|
2022-07-04 17:28:23 +01:00 |
xeruf
|
f356cc6a53
|
zulip: fix auth backends
https://zulip.readthedocs.io/en/latest/production/authentication-methods.html#email-and-password
Had to check settings.py for details
|
2022-07-04 17:26:46 +01:00 |
xeruf
|
f1504948d0
|
gitea: add pvcs
|
2022-07-04 11:18:51 +01:00 |
xeruf
|
ca9a3611ce
|
basic: raise kustomization intervals
|
2022-07-03 18:08:12 +01:00 |
xeruf
|
56872ebaae
|
suitecrm: update tls and version to 11.1.9
|
2022-07-03 18:07:52 +01:00 |
xeruf
|
cbf9911b5f
|
apps: properly configure staging letsencrypt
|
2022-07-03 17:48:45 +01:00 |
xeruf
|
f4fe3a1ad0
|
overrides: enable variable substitution
|
2022-07-01 22:07:49 +01:00 |
xeruf
|
3ca1dbbcbe
|
production: simplify health checks
According to https://fluxcd.io/docs/components/kustomize/kustomization/#recommended-settings
|
2022-07-01 22:03:53 +01:00 |
xeruf
|
bcaafa4af5
|
zulip: correct override name
|
2022-07-01 21:57:36 +01:00 |
xeruf
|
3809e6778e
|
basic: create and use letsencrypt staging issuer
|
2022-07-01 21:54:48 +01:00 |
xeruf
|
5a47fc8ba2
|
gitea: update to https
|
2022-06-30 14:37:48 +01:00 |
xeruf
|
e0496141ee
|
production: adjust kustomization healthChecks
|
2022-06-30 14:13:50 +01:00 |
xeruf
|
f357edf973
|
zulip: reenable email auth
|
2022-06-30 14:13:37 +01:00 |
xeruf
|
59132c9224
|
gitea: add k8s kustomization
|
2022-06-30 13:09:00 +01:00 |
xeruf
|
1feb8b98c7
|
gitea: update oauth callback path to http
|
2022-06-30 11:58:38 +01:00 |
xeruf
|
b5ec0c73d8
|
vikunja: update container versions
|
2022-06-30 11:35:49 +01:00 |
xeruf
|
b7de2a2a64
|
vikunja: add temporary extra host to circumvent LE limit
https://letsencrypt.org/docs/duplicate-certificate-limit/
|
2022-06-30 11:32:17 +01:00 |
xeruf
|
be363e87ee
|
apps: issue adjustments
|
2022-06-30 09:12:09 +01:00 |
xeruf
|
087a3be229
|
vikunja: adjust redirectUri back in oauth2client
|
2022-06-30 09:01:38 +01:00 |
xeruf
|
cd858612be
|
vikunja: adjust redirecturl in configmap
|
2022-06-30 08:58:49 +01:00 |
xeruf
|
63b223ba3e
|
vikunja: adjust redirectUri to network observations
|
2022-06-30 08:55:40 +01:00 |
xeruf
|
01d2875f1d
|
vikunja: revert provider name change test
|
2022-06-30 08:54:59 +01:00 |
xeruf
|
f05ee36259
|
vikunja: test different provider name
|
2022-06-30 08:52:14 +01:00 |
xeruf
|
8ca67187f5
|
vikunja: fix redirectUri typo
|
2022-06-30 08:45:11 +01:00 |
xeruf
|
bcfe98fd6b
|
apps: reenable redirectUris
|
2022-06-30 08:29:07 +01:00 |
xeruf
|
4171b498bd
|
apps: requote acme tls trues
|
2022-06-30 08:24:12 +01:00 |
xeruf
|
8868a66812
|
suitecrm: add people app
|
2022-06-29 23:59:48 +01:00 |
xeruf
|
c0dfdc041f
|
vikunja: unset sso redirection
|
2022-06-29 23:59:22 +01:00 |
xeruf
|
4ae7af92f1
|
dev: fix gitea sso discovery
|
2022-06-29 23:53:16 +01:00 |
xeruf
|
a59a74b3e3
|
apps: parametrize variables
|
2022-06-29 23:41:48 +01:00 |
xeruf
|
5a0a500265
|
Move to flux-system namespace
|
2022-06-29 23:11:29 +01:00 |
xeruf
|
32c5ab85d3
|
production: set correct folder paths
|
2022-06-29 22:55:50 +01:00 |
xeruf
|
0d85ecdb6a
|
production: set correct app kustomization namespace
|
2022-06-29 22:49:04 +01:00 |
xeruf
|
0a05dbeb22
|
Create per-app kustomizations
|
2022-06-29 22:33:54 +01:00 |
xeruf
|
2137b80af8
|
Hardcode the domain for the meantime
|
2022-06-28 11:42:58 +01:00 |
xeruf
|
39ef8084ad
|
gitea: fix configmap typo
Kustomization reconciliation failed: ConfigMap/stackspout/stackspin-gitea-values dry-run failed, error: failed to create typed patch object (stackspout/stackspin-gitea-values; /v1, Kind=ConfigMap): .data.values.yaml: expected string, got &value.valueUnstructured{Value:map[string]interface {}{"ingress":map[string]interface {}{"annotations":map[string]interface {}{"kubernetes.io/tls-acme":"true"}, "enabled":true, "hosts":[]interface {}{map[string]interface {}{"host":"dev.${domain}", "paths":[]interface {}{map[string]interface {}{"path":"/", "pathType":"Prefix"}}}}, "tls":[]interface {}{map[string]interface {}{"hosts":[]interface {}{"dev.${domain}"}, "secretName":"gitea-tls"}}}}}
|
2022-06-28 11:07:31 +01:00 |